Ricky Bobby OG
OG Kush × OG-leaning hybrid
Ricky Bobby OG is a hybrid cannabis strain characterized by its OG lineage and a potent, gas-forward aroma. Primarily found in craft markets, it offers a classic cannabis experience with modern potency.
Appearance
Ricky Bobby OG typically produces dense, spear-shaped colas with tightly stacked calyxes. The flowers are usually a lime to forest green, adorned with vibrant orange pistils and a heavy coating of trichomes that give them a silvery appearance. When grown under optimal conditions, the buds exhibit sharp definition and a high calyx-to-leaf ratio, making them visually appealing and easier to trim.
Aroma & Flavor
The aroma of Ricky Bobby OG is dominated by a strong gas or diesel-fuel scent, complemented by notes of pine and lemon. Upon closer inspection, hints of pepper and earthiness can be detected. The flavor profile closely mirrors the aroma, offering a combination of diesel, pine, citrus, and a peppery finish, with some users noting earthy or toasted notes when combusted.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ids
While specific lab data is limited, Ricky Bobby OG's terpene profile is understood to be OG-dominant. Common terpenes include myrcene, limonene, and beta-caryophyllene, with supporting notes of terpinolene and humulene. Some variations may include traces of linalool or ocimene. THC levels typically range from 19% to 26%, with CBD content usually below 1%.
Growing
Ricky Bobby OG is considered an OG-first plant to cultivate, requiring attention to nutrient balance and environmental conditions. It typically exhibits moderate stretch during the flip to flower. The strain is known for producing resin-heavy flowers, making it a good candidate for concentrate production. Environmental control, particularly VPD and PPFD, can influence bud structure and resin development.
Origins & Lineage
Ricky Bobby OG is believed to have emerged in the late 2010s or early 2020s, fitting into a trend of OG-adjacent phenotype selections. Its lineage is generally considered OG-dominant, likely stemming from an OG Kush cross or a hybrid with strong OG characteristics. Its exact breeder is not widely publicized, contributing to its boutique status and diffusion through clone sharing.
